Dark Mode for Elementor

Description

The first Dark Mode plugin custom tailored for Elementor websites!

Dark Mode Toggle Widget – Includes a dark mode toggle widget for custom button text, styling, placement and more.

Floating Button – Includes an option to use a predefined floating button with custom colors and placement control.

Automatic Dark Mode – Requires no additional styling or coding to get dark mode on all pages.

Match Device Theme – Automatically shows Darkmode if the OS prefered theme is dark.

Save User Choice – The plugin is able to save the user choice and show the prefered mode.

Exclude Pages – The plugin allows you to exclude specific pages & posts, dark mode will not initiate on selected pages/posts.

FAQ

Can I exclude some pages ?

Yes, you can exclude any page/post.

Can I customize the button ?

You have the option to use the predefined floating button, or use the Dark Mode Toggle widget and customize it to your liking.
